Finding Divine Answers in Everyday Moments

Gerson Rufino's song "A Resposta de Deus" delves into the human experience of seeking divine guidance and feeling the weight of unanswered prayers. The lyrics capture the emotional turmoil of repeatedly asking for God's intervention, only to feel ignored or overlooked. This sense of desperation is palpable as the singer questions the reasons behind the delay and the diminishing hope that accompanies each passing day without a clear response.

The song emphasizes that God's answers may not always come in the form we expect. Instead, they can be found in the subtle, everyday moments that we often overlook. Rufino suggests that divine messages might be hidden in a neighbor's song, a discarded pamphlet, a grateful glance from a stranger, or a simple "I love you" from a child. These seemingly mundane occurrences are portrayed as potential vessels for God's communication, urging listeners to remain open and attentive to the signs around them.

By highlighting these small, yet significant moments, Rufino encourages a shift in perspective. The song invites listeners to recognize and appreciate the divine presence in their daily lives, even when it feels like their prayers are going unanswered. This message is both comforting and challenging, as it calls for a deeper awareness and a more profound trust in the subtle ways that God might be speaking to us. Ultimately, "A Resposta de Deus" is a reminder that divine answers are often closer than we think, hidden in the fabric of our everyday experiences.
